London Business School podcasts

London Business School podcasts

By London Business School

A series of podcasts, sharing the latest in news and thought leadership from London Business School.... more

  • 5
  • 5
  • 5
  • 5
  • 5

5

5 ratings


Download on the App Store

London Business School podcasts episodes:

FAQs about London Business School podcasts:

How many episodes does London Business School podcasts have?

The podcast currently has 292 episodes available.